1. Daikakuji GuyotDaikakuji Seamount is a seamount and the southwesternmost volcanic feature in the Hawaiian Emperor chain bend area. The seamount is very close to the "V"-shaped bend in the Hawaiian-Emperor seamount chain, and thus would be useful in understanding the exact age of the bend. Although few dredge samples are available, they have all been reliably dated at 43 million years.
